Check Track Tension
Check track tension at startup and every 10
hours and adjust as needed. Track is correctly
tensioned when measurement between track and
straight edges (2) is 1/2 in (13 mm).
To adjust:
1.
Park machine on smooth flat surface.
2.
Lay straight edge on top of track, spanning
from sprocket to front idler roller.
3.
Clean track cylinder zerk (1). Pump MPG into
zerk until distance between track and straight
edge (2) is 1/2” (13 mm).
4.
Test
: Drive forward one track length and
check tension again.
•
If tension is too loose, repeat step 3
above.
•
If tension is too tight, loosen fitting on
grease cylinder and allow a small
amount of grease to discharge from
cylinder. Tighten fitting and test again.
Check Coolant Level
Check coolant level, with engine cool, at overflow
bottle at startup and every 10 hours. Maintain
coolant level at halfway point on bottle. If low, add
approved coolant.
IMPORTANT:
See page 56 for information on
approved coolants.
